1965 250 SE Automatic
Originally sold and registered in Australia. Documents in the history file show the car was sold new in 1965 to A H Francis. That name shows in the history and registration documents throughout the cars ownership in Australia, the last address being noted as a retirement village. It is believed the car remained in singe ownership from 1965 until being brought to the UK. I am the only UK owner so as far as I am aware it is only a two owner car from new. The mileage of 12, 296 is thought to be correct but can’t be verified.
Registered in the UK since 2020 the car has been my collection but seldom used so time for someone else to enjoy it. Always garaged and regularly started.
Expect some light recommissioning given the almost zero use in many years. Starts, drives and stops but most mechanical bits need a run through.
Absolutely solid throughout, underside is excellent with no sighs of rust.
History file contains sales receipt and written correspondence between A H Francis and B. E. A Distributers who I understand to be the suppling dealer. Photocopy of original warranty card. Also on file is a letter dated 2020 from Mercedes Benz UK Homologation Department confirming the cars chassis number, engine number, date of manufacture, country of manufacture and country of first registration being Australia.
Original book pack and tool kit present.
Paint work is excellent. Interior is very good bar some cracking on the dash and usual fading of dash trims.
Very solid and pretty example of this iconic car with an interesting history.
